Hi everyone, I made it to week 11 :-) yeah me. 1 lb lost this week. That's 32 lbs to date.

I must admit I did think that I would lose more, HOWEVER I have noticed such an increase in muscle all over. Where I couldn't feel muscle before, I do now.

I tried on 4 different pairs of jeans/trousers this week that did not fit me what so ever!! and this week they all fit :-) This is an amazing result which just inspires me to work just as hard if not harder as I continue on my journey.

I have done 403 minutes of exercise this week. I have stepped it up and broke down some walls. I have really pushed and am really happy with all I have achieved this week.

Here's to week 12. Bring it on. I wish everyone a happy week and successful weight loss x

Well done, what a success, as you have been able to actually lose substantial weight, can you give a few tips. I cannot do a lot of exercise due to heart problems that are still under investigation, but I can swim and walk up to about a mile. However I would love to hear your general regime as I am finding it difficult to lose, one week lose 3 lbs and then put it back on, so please any advice gratefully received. Often very busy and then go for a biscuit to keep me going, or munch in front of tele, also hard to not snack in between healthy meals, not good I know but have to be honest.

Hi Coho and thank you. I eat 3 meals a day and have and snake on fruit. So for breakfast I would eat Weetabix or have scrambled egg on 1 slice whole wheat toast with a small portion of beans. Snack at 11 am so that would be fruit and 2 crackers. Lunch would be soup or turkey salad sandwich/pita and I would have my dinner, but I don't eat anything after 6 pm at the latest which may sound early to some but I am in bed for 9 am or 9:30 most days. Finding a routine that you can stick to will really help you on your journey I find that my routine is easy to stick to as it is worked around my day and my commitments.

I believe that reaching for a snack such as a biscuit is out of habit and to lose the weight we have to break those habits that got us here in the first place and be more active in life. When I was at my healthiest weight I wasn't sedentary, I just became this way. Life got tough for me and I was stressed and to pass the time of day I would eat mindlessly and didn't care, but I woke up one day and found that I am happy with life why not change the way I look and be even more happy. So I did 11 weeks ago to be exact and I don't want to ever look back. I am making these changes for me and you can to. Believe that you can and you will succeed on your journey. You can walk a mile then try walking a mile everyday and you can swim which is a great exercise so go for it. I wish you every success on your journey.
